Transaction 440e77596c381d13d5993e418e20740e460dce8277241b636bb4f3cc14df0e03
1 Input
2 Outputs
- 440e77596c381d13d5993e418e20740e460dce8277241b636bb4f3cc14df0e03:0
- 440e77596c381d13d5993e418e20740e460dce8277241b636bb4f3cc14df0e03:1
value 2598703
address 3H4odUnkvJXMrAsokmDxsFJMwyqXNu3ocW
value 10383462
address 16ZGYY4yWm8EtfWeWmnZRuiPvveJKTSRxn